Obituary

Funeral services for Malcolm Sumner Spray, age 78 of Fayetteville, will be conducted Wednesday August 12, 2015 at 2 PM at Higgins Funeral Home with Bro. Joe Wayne McGee officiating. Burial will follow in Lebanon Cemetery. Mr. Spray passed away Monday August 10, 2015 at his residence.
A native of Lincoln County, Mr. Spray was the son of the late Homer Raymond and Mildred Sumners Spray. He was a retired employee of the H. D. Lee Company and a member of the Church of Christ.
Survivors include his wife Ann Barnes Spray of Fayetteville, daughter Annette (Mike) Mitchell of Dellrose, brothers James Wilson Spray of Fayetteville, Billy Clark Spray of Flintville, three sisters Emily Rae Tate of Lewisburg, Loretta Pitcock and Becky O’Neal both of Fayetteville, five grandchildren and nine great-grandchildren.
Visitation with the family will be Wednesday August 12, 2015 from 1:30 -2 PM at Higgins Funeral Home.
